From the Peptide Explorer
A cyclic heptapeptide and non-selective melanocortin receptor agonist. Melanotan II activates MC1R (melanogenesis), MC3R, MC4R (sexual function/appetite), and MC5R, giving it a broad biological profile. It was the parent compound from which PT-141 was derived.
Key Mechanisms
- ›MC1R agonism (melanin production)
- ›MC4R agonism (sexual function, appetite)
- ›MC3R agonism
- ›Broad melanocortin receptor activation
- ›UV-independent melanogenesis
Primary Research Areas
- ›Melanogenesis
- ›UV-independent tanning research
- ›Sexual function
- ›Appetite regulation
Key Research Findings
- Stimulated melanin production and UV-independent skin darkening in human subjects
- Parent compound for PT-141; demonstrated sexual function effects via MC4R
- Broad melanocortin activation profile limits clinical selectivity
